Output 64a6a40365b80099015fae27843e03b3e574489f8fcdf002b86e1effa5d6996c:1

value
7044449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ed003185e940dd746df4d98f580e4c47fcd978c OP_EQUAL
address
333LaAPx7abiypdkFRdMG2akKnK2HJe9W5
transaction
64a6a40365b80099015fae27843e03b3e574489f8fcdf002b86e1effa5d6996c
confirmations
355026
spent
true